Chrysler has released the first official images of the refreshed Chrysler Pacifica, previewing the updated minivan set to arrive for the 2027 model year. The popular family hauler receives a noticeable exterior redesign, highlighted by an all-new front fascia.

The most striking change is up front. The redesigned Pacifica now features vertically oriented headlights that flow downward along the edges of the front end. These lighting elements are visually connected by a full-width light bar stretching across the upper grille. Integrated into that light bar is Chrysler’s updated winged logo — a simplified emblem first introduced on the 2024 Chrysler Halcyon concept vehicle and now making its way to a production model for the first time.

While Chrysler hasn’t released detailed specifications, the refreshed styling clearly marks a departure from the outgoing model’s slim, horizontal headlights. The new front design also incorporates a large lower grille with intricate chrome detailing. A chrome accent strip runs along the van’s side profile, and the model shown wears a “Pinnacle” badge, indicating it represents the top trim level. Chrysler has yet to reveal the rear design.

Inside, updates are expected as well. Though interior images haven’t been shared, the cabin will likely receive a more contemporary layout with larger displays and updated technology to remain competitive in the segment.

Under the hood, the 3.6-liter V-6 engine is expected to carry over, though it remains unclear whether Chrysler will introduce mechanical upgrades. Earlier this year, parent company Stellantis discontinued its traditional plug-in hybrid models, effectively ending the Pacifica Hybrid variant that paired the V-6 engine with dual electric motors.

However, Chrysler has previously hinted at electrified plans for the Pacifica lineup. In 2024, CEO Christine Feuell stated that a fully electric Pacifica could follow shortly after the updated gasoline version. Whether those plans remain intact is still uncertain.

For now, the refreshed 2027 Pacifica signals renewed momentum for Chrysler, which has relied heavily on the minivan since discontinuing the 300 sedan after the 2023 model year. More details about the updated Pacifica are expected to surface in the coming months.
